Summary

To enact section 3701.142 of the Revised Code to require the Director of Health to establish pilot programs in seven counties for the purpose of providing door-to-door health checks by nurses or other health professionals in neighborhoods or areas that have traditionally lacked access to health care providers or services and to make an appropriation for the biennium beginning on July 1, 2007.
